Abstract

CVE 2000 San Francisco CA USA Copyright ACM 2000 1-58113-303-0/00/09...$5.00 ABSTRACT Existing immersed virtual reality and particularly augmented reality systems are usually based on dedicated and expensive hardware and I/O devices. Nevertheless they often provide limited support for the collaboration between multiple users and can hardly be used for arbitrary location independent application environments. Additionally, navigation and interaction within such virtual environments are not very natural or intuitive, making them difficult to use. This paper will introduce a new collaborative augmented reality environment the Virtual Round Table. This environment is designed to support location-independent mixed reality applications, overcoming the limitations for collaboration and interaction of existing approaches. Moreover it extends the physical workplace of the users into the virtual environment, while preserving traditional verbal and non-verbal communication and cooperation mechanisms.
